1. Content Creation: Turn Your Passion into Profit

Do you have a way with words, a knack for photography, or a burning passion for a particular niche? The online world craves fresh content, and students can leverage their creativity to build an audience and generate income. Here are some content creation avenues to explore:

  • Blogging: If you have a passion for a particular topic, like fashion, gaming, or student life, consider starting a blog. Build a loyal audience by consistently creating engaging content. Once you’ve established a following, you can explore monetization options such as advertising, affiliate marketing, or even selling your own products or ebooks.

  • Freelance Writing: Several websites connect freelance writers with clients seeking content for websites, blogs, or articles. Showcase your writing skills and land gigs that align with your interests and expertise. Freelance writing platforms like Upwork or Fiverr are a good starting point.

  • Social Media Management: Businesses of all sizes understand the power of social media engagement. If you’re a social media whiz who thrives on creating engaging content and managing online communities, offer your services to local businesses. Help them craft compelling content, manage their online presence, and interact with their audience.

  • YouTube: For the creative and camera-friendly student, YouTube offers a fantastic platform to share your knowledge, hobbies, or comedic talents. Build a subscriber base by consistently creating engaging videos. Once you’ve established yourself, you can explore monetization options like ads, sponsorships, or even selling your own merchandise.

2. Online Tutoring and Teaching: Share Your Knowledge and Empower Others

Did you ace that calculus class or effortlessly master the intricacies of French grammar? Your knowledge can be a valuable asset to others! Numerous online tutoring platforms connect students with tutors in various subjects. Platforms like Chegg or Wyzant allow you to set your own schedule and help others achieve academic success. There are also opportunities to tutor English as a Second Language (ESL) online, catering to students worldwide.

3. Online Surveys and Microtasks: Earn While You Learn (But Don’t Expect a Fortune)

While not a path to riches, online surveys and microtask websites offer a way to earn small amounts in your free time. These tasks can involve taking surveys, data entry, content moderation, or simple online activities like image tagging. Sites like Amazon Mechanical Turk or Prolific offer microtasks, but it’s important to be mindful of the time commitment versus potential earnings. Treat these options as a way to earn a little extra cash here and there, rather than a primary source of income.

5. Online Transcription: Turn Listening into Earning

Companies often need audio or video recordings transcribed into text format. If you have excellent listening skills and a good typing speed, online transcription services can be a good fit. Websites like Rev or Scribie offer transcription jobs with flexible hours, allowing you to work from the comfort of your dorm room.

6. Online Customer Service: Providing Support from Anywhere

Many companies offer remote customer service positions. If you have good communication and problem-solving skills, you can provide support to customers via chat, email, or phone. This can be a flexible way to earn money online, while also gaining valuable experience in customer service.
